I think the biggest thing we had to avoid in the 1st two rounds was a team that had some sort of interior size/rebounding advantage over us.  If we shoot so poorly that we lose to SDSU then we DESERVE the loss.  And against VCU, it is strength on strength.  We are the the best at preventing turnovers, they are the best at causing them.  So bring it--I bet our guys can keep the turnovers limited enough to keep VCU from getting too many cheap points while at the same time I expect several fast break dunks coming after Burke & Co. break the press down.

It won't be easy, but what HAS been easy for this team in the last month?  If they don't start playing better then they have been it won't matter past the first weekend anyway.

Our biggest challenge in that game will be deciding when to take the bait and beat them at the own game and make them pay for pressing and when to pull it back out and run a half court set.  If we are able to beat the press consistently there could be a ton of open  threes for our wings.  My biggest fear is the JB will play it just break the press and regroup at half court.  VCU is a team that could beat us, they are also a team that we could run out of the gym like Tenessee 2011 if we take it to them after we break the press.
